greenplumn CParseHandlerLogicalSetOp 代码
文件路径:/src/backend/gporca/libnaucrates/src/parser/CParseHandlerLogicalSetOp.cpp

#include "naucrates/dxl/parser/CParseHandlerLogicalSetOp.h"
#include "naucrates/dxl/operators/CDXLOperatorFactory.h"
#include "naucrates/dxl/parser/CParseHandlerColDescr.h"
#include "naucrates/dxl/parser/CParseHandlerFactory.h"
using namespace gpdxl;
XERCES_CPP_NAMESPACE_USE
/---------------------------------------------------------------------------
/ @function:
/ CParseHandlerLogicalSetOp::CParseHandlerLogicalSetOp
/
/ @doc:
/ Ctor
/
/---------------------------------------------------------------------------
CParseHandlerLogicalSetOp::CParseHandlerLogicalSetOp(
CMemoryPool *mp, CParseHandlerManager *parse_handler_mgr,
CParseHandlerBase *parse_handler_root)
: CParseHandlerLogicalOp(mp, parse_handler_mgr, parse_handler_root),
m_setop_type(EdxlsetopSentinel),
m_input_colids_arrays(nullptr),
m_cast_across_input_req(false)
{
}
/---------------------------------------------------------------------------
/ @function:
/ CParseHandlerLogicalSetOp::~CParseHandlerLogicalSetOp
/
/ @doc:
/ Dtor
/
/---------------------------------------------------------------------------
CParseHandlerLogicalSetOp::~CParseHandlerLogicalSetOp() = default;
/---------------------------------------------------------------------------
/ @function:
/ CParseHandlerLogicalSetOp::StartElement
/
/ @doc:
/ Invoked by Xerces to process an opening tag
/
/---------------------------------------------------------------------------
void
CParseHandlerLogicalSetOp::StartElement(const XMLCh *const element_uri,
const XMLCh *const element_local_name,
const XMLCh *const element_qname,
const Attributes &attrs)
{
if (0 == this->Length())
{
m_setop_type = GetSetOpType(element_local_name);
if (EdxlsetopSentinel == m_setop_type)
{
GPOS_RAISE(gpdxl::ExmaDXL, gpdxl::ExmiDXLUnexpectedTag,
CDXLUtils::CreateDynamicStringFromXMLChArray(
m_parse_handler_mgr->GetDXLMemoryManager(),
element_local_name)
->GetBuffer());
}
/ parse array of input colid arrays
const XMLCh *input_colids_array_str =
attrs.getValue(CDXLTokens::XmlstrToken(EdxltokenInputCols));
m_input_colids_arrays =
CDXLOperatorFactory::ExtractConvertUlongTo2DArray(
m_parse_handler_mgr->GetDXLMemoryManager(),
input_colids_array_str, EdxltokenInputCols,
EdxltokenLogicalSetOperation);
/ install column descriptor parsers
CParseHandlerBase *col_descr_parse_handler =
CParseHandlerFactory::GetParseHandler(
m_mp, CDXLTokens::XmlstrToken(EdxltokenColumns),
m_parse_handler_mgr, this);
m_parse_handler_mgr->ActivateParseHandler(col_descr_parse_handler);
m_cast_across_input_req =
CDXLOperatorFactory::ExtractConvertAttrValueToBool(
m_parse_handler_mgr->GetDXLMemoryManager(), attrs,
EdxltokenCastAcrossInputs, EdxltokenLogicalSetOperation);
/ store child parse handler in array
this->Append(col_descr_parse_handler);
}
else
{
/ already have seen a set operation
GPOS_ASSERT(EdxlsetopSentinel != m_setop_type);
/ create child node parsers
CParseHandlerBase *child_parse_handler =
CParseHandlerFactory::GetParseHandler(
m_mp, CDXLTokens::XmlstrToken(EdxltokenLogical),
m_parse_handler_mgr, this);
m_parse_handler_mgr->ActivateParseHandler(child_parse_handler);
this->Append(child_parse_handler);
child_parse_handler->startElement(element_uri, element_local_name,
element_qname, attrs);
}
}
/---------------------------------------------------------------------------
/ @function:
/ CParseHandlerLogicalSetOp::GetSetOpType
/
/ @doc:
/ Invoked by Xerces to process a closing tag
/
/---------------------------------------------------------------------------
EdxlSetOpType
CParseHandlerLogicalSetOp::GetSetOpType(const XMLCh *const element_local_name)
{
if (0 ==
XMLString::compareString(CDXLTokens::XmlstrToken(EdxltokenLogicalUnion),
element_local_name))
{
return EdxlsetopUnion;
}
if (0 == XMLString::compareString(
CDXLTokens::XmlstrToken(EdxltokenLogicalUnionAll),
element_local_name))
{
return EdxlsetopUnionAll;
}
if (0 == XMLString::compareString(
CDXLTokens::XmlstrToken(EdxltokenLogicalIntersect),
element_local_name))
{
return EdxlsetopIntersect;
}
if (0 == XMLString::compareString(
CDXLTokens::XmlstrToken(EdxltokenLogicalIntersectAll),
element_local_name))
{
return EdxlsetopIntersectAll;
}
if (0 == XMLString::compareString(
CDXLTokens::XmlstrToken(EdxltokenLogicalDifference),
element_local_name))
{
return EdxlsetopDifference;
}
if (0 == XMLString::compareString(
CDXLTokens::XmlstrToken(EdxltokenLogicalDifferenceAll),
element_local_name))
{
return EdxlsetopDifferenceAll;
}
return EdxlsetopSentinel;
}
/---------------------------------------------------------------------------
/ @function:
/ CParseHandlerLogicalSetOp::EndElement
/
/ @doc:
/ Invoked by Xerces to process a closing tag
/
/---------------------------------------------------------------------------
void
CParseHandlerLogicalSetOp::EndElement(const XMLCh *const, / element_uri,
const XMLCh *const element_local_name,
const XMLCh *const / element_qname
)
{
EdxlSetOpType setop_type = GetSetOpType(element_local_name);
if (EdxlsetopSentinel == setop_type && m_setop_type != setop_type)
{
CWStringDynamic *str = CDXLUtils::CreateDynamicStringFromXMLChArray(
m_parse_handler_mgr->GetDXLMemoryManager(), element_local_name);
GPOS_RAISE(gpdxl::ExmaDXL, gpdxl::ExmiDXLUnexpectedTag,
str->GetBuffer());
}
const ULONG length = this->Length();
GPOS_ASSERT(3 <= length);
/ get the columns descriptors
CParseHandlerColDescr *col_descr_parse_handler =
dynamic_cast<CParseHandlerColDescr *>((*this)[0]);
GPOS_ASSERT(nullptr != col_descr_parse_handler->GetDXLColumnDescrArray());
CDXLColDescrArray *cold_descr_dxl_array =
col_descr_parse_handler->GetDXLColumnDescrArray();
cold_descr_dxl_array->AddRef();
CDXLLogicalSetOp *dxl_op = GPOS_NEW(m_mp)
CDXLLogicalSetOp(m_mp, setop_type, cold_descr_dxl_array,
m_input_colids_arrays, m_cast_across_input_req);
m_dxl_node = GPOS_NEW(m_mp) CDXLNode(m_mp, dxl_op);
for (ULONG idx = 1; idx < length; idx++)
{
/ add constructed logical children from child parse handlers
CParseHandlerLogicalOp *child_parse_handler =
dynamic_cast<CParseHandlerLogicalOp *>((*this)[idx]);
AddChildFromParseHandler(child_parse_handler);
}
#ifdef GPOS_DEBUG
m_dxl_node->GetOperator()->AssertValid(m_dxl_node,
false /* validate_children */);
#endif / GPOS_DEBUG
/ deactivate handler
m_parse_handler_mgr->DeactivateHandler();
}
